Understanding SSL Security and Its Importance
The importance of SSL protection in online settings, Member Login, particularly in the realm of online casinos like 21BIT, cannot be underestimated. SSL, or Secure Sockets Layer, establishes an encrypted link between users and the website, guaranteeing that private data such as personal data and financial records remain confidential. Despite this, SSL flaws can still create significant risks if not managed; outdated standards and misconfigurations can expose user data to potential breaches. Consequently, increasing user knowledge regarding SSL markers—such as the appearance of HTTPS and padlock icons—becomes crucial. By comprehending these factors, users can better safeguard themselves against cyber dangers, strengthening the critical role of SSL technology in protecting online exchanges and nurturing trust within the online gaming community.

Encryption Process Explained
Encryption serves as a cornerstone of SSL technology, facilitating safe data transmission over the internet. The process involves converting plaintext into ciphertext using advanced encryption standards such as AES or RSA, ensuring that data remains private during transmission. When a user connects to a secure site, the SSL handshake establishes a secure session, utilizing digital signatures to verify the validity of the SSL certificate. This verification prevents eavesdropping, as only legitimate servers possess authentic certificates. Subsequently, symmetric encryption is utilized for ongoing communication, leveraging session keys derived during the handshake. This two-layer approach—combining asymmetric and symmetric encryption—offers robust protection, ensuring that confidential information, such as login credentials at 21BIT Casino, is transmitted safely and safely.
